GMCA Foundational Economy Innovation Fund

16 Feb 2023 - 14:35 by michelle.foster

Formal applications are now open for the GMCA’s new Foundational Economy Innovation Fund. The fund will provide grants and support for businesses and organisations in Greater Manchester’s funding“foundational” or “everyday” economy to trial innovative new ideas and improved ways of working.

The grant funding will be in 2 phases: Phase 1 will provide £10,000 grants for up to 40 projects to develop and test innovations and ideas. This will be followed by Phase 2 where £60,000 grants will be available for up to 10 projects to develop the best ideas from Phase 1. Participants will receive support on innovation and be invited to join a new community of innovators.

Applications are at this stage open for stage 1 funding. The “foundational economy” is the “everyday economy”, or the “essential economy” – the businesses we all rely on for our daily needs.

The fund is starting with four sectors and asking people who run businesses or enterprises in these sectors, work with the sectors, or have solutions that can be used in these sectors to apply. These sectors are:

  • Health and Social Care
  • Early Education and Childcare
  • Retail and Personal Services
  • Hospitality and Leisure
